Multiple Radio Button Group Validation Using Javascript

JavaScript and client side scripting.

Moderator: General Moderators

Post Reply
justravis
Forum Commoner
Posts: 53
Joined: Mon Dec 16, 2002 3:18 am
Location: San Diego, CA
Contact:

Multiple Radio Button Group Validation Using Javascript

Post by justravis »

I have a form with questions numbered 1-19. Each question has 5 radio buttons named after the number. Trying to develop one function to check for values.

can var nbr be used instead of field name? Any other ideas why it is not working?

Example Radio Group:

Code: Select all

<input type=radio class=noborder name=1 value=0>0
<input type=radio class=noborder name=1 value=1>1
<input type=radio class=noborder name=1 value=2>2
<input type=radio class=noborder name=1 value=3>3
<input type=radio class=noborder name=1 value=4>4
Javascript Function:

Code: Select all

<script language=javascript>

function radiochk()
&#123;
        //LOOP THROUGH EACH QUESTION
        for(nbr=1; nbr<=19; nbr++)
        &#123;
                //LOOP THROUGH EACH BTN
                for(i=0; i<thisform.nbr.length; i++)
                &#123;
                        if(thisform.nbr&#1111;i].checked)
                        &#123;
                                noalert=thisform.nbr&#1111;i].value;

                                break;
                        &#125;
                &#125;
                //LOOP THROUGH EACH BTN

                if(noalert!='')
                &#123;
                        alert('All fields are required.');

                        return false;
                &#125;
        &#125;
        //LOOP THROUGH EACH QUESTION
&#125;

</script>
Post Reply